Output 30f379880bd167126a35946c595ac64eb1075df27109ad63230800030ffb1d7f:1

value
840255904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43bc849d9729125b04329135cb45d8c9678bdac0 OP_EQUAL
address
37sB2rkzmphv2ybZqRJUsDxELhFBksCpZ5
transaction
30f379880bd167126a35946c595ac64eb1075df27109ad63230800030ffb1d7f
spent
true